Joe Arundel (born 22 August 1991 in Yorkshire) is an English professional rugby league footballer for Hull FC in the Super League. He plays as a centre.

Joe made his debut for Castleford in a Super League game against Huddersfield in 2008.[2]

Joe played in 9 games for Castleford in 2010 and impressed scoring 2 tries. He has been handed the number 4 jersey for the 2011 season as is expected to be a starter each week.

On the 25th of April 2014, Joe signed for Bradford for the rest of the season on loan along with Hull F.C. team-mate Jay Pitts.[3][4]
